About the Department
The soil management is a new extension and research program in the Department of Crop and Soil Sciences at North Carolina State University. The program is located at Vernon G James Center, Tidewater Research Station, Plymouth, NC. The primary focus is soil health, soil organic matter, and saltwater intrusion-related issues. Soil impacts and spatial technologies for major field crops are within the scope of this program. As cropping systems change, new spatial technologies will require applied research and extension to ensure the best soil management and fertilizer recommendations for optimal yields and economic return while safeguarding soil health and soil organic matter. Additionally, saltwater intrusion and storm effects on soil productivity and fertility are and will be an increasingly important part of this position.

Essential Job Duties
We are seeking two independent and motivated Research Technicians to support our extension and research program through both field and laboratory work. In this role, you will contribute to the scientific perspective of our efforts, assist with data collection and analysis, and maintain research tools and equipment. The position involves operating heavy field equipment, performing maintenance tasks, and participating in outdoor fieldwork. Safety, accuracy, and scientific rigor are essential.

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ct laboratory work and record, manage, and analyze experimental data.
  • Operate and maintain field equipment, performing minor repairs as needed.
  • Collaborate with staff, students, and other team members to ensure smooth research operations.
  • Follow all safety protocols and compliance standards in field and lab settings.
